When a water system has a problem, the natural response is often to add something.
Another filter. Another chemical. Another treatment stage. Another piece of equipment.
It can seem logical: if one solution helps, adding more solutions should produce better results.
But water treatment doesn’t always work that way.
Sometimes, a system becomes so complicated that the treatment process itself becomes harder to manage, more expensive to operate, and more difficult to understand.
More Equipment Doesn’t Always Mean Better Results
Every additional component in a water treatment system brings its own requirements.
It needs to be installed, operated, maintained, monitored, and eventually repaired or replaced.
If several treatment methods are being used without considering how they interact, the system can become unnecessarily complicated.
The result can be higher operating costs without a proportional improvement in performance.
Start With the Actual Problem
One of the biggest mistakes in water management is treating the symptom instead of understanding the cause.
If water quality is changing, for example, the answer isn’t automatically to introduce another treatment process.
First, it is worth asking:
What is causing the problem?
Is it related to the water source?
Is the system overloaded?
Is there insufficient movement?
Is organic material accumulating?
Is existing equipment being used correctly?
Has the operating environment changed?
Understanding the problem can prevent unnecessary treatment from being added to the system.
Simple Systems Can Be Easier to Manage
A simpler system isn’t necessarily a less effective system.
When equipment and processes are properly matched to the application, operators can have a clearer understanding of what each component is doing and why it is needed.
This can make maintenance easier, reduce unnecessary operating requirements, and make it easier to identify problems when something changes.
The goal shouldn’t be to build the most complicated treatment system possible.
The goal should be to build the system that actually makes sense for the application.
Think About the Long-Term Cost
The initial price of equipment is only one part of the cost of water treatment.
Energy consumption, maintenance, consumables, replacement parts, labour, and downtime can all contribute to the long-term operating cost.
A solution that looks affordable at installation may become expensive over several years if it requires constant maintenance or high ongoing operating costs.
That is why water treatment decisions should be considered from both a technical and operational perspective.
